Can Andy Burnham's revolution fix Britain?
Jun 29, 2026 · 45m
Summary
The News Agents analyze Andy Burnham’s speech outlining a radical shift toward devolved power and a "Number 10 North," questioning if decentralization will restore public trust. They discuss the chaotic "lame duck" period under Keir Starmer, including Home Office infighting, and speculate on Burnham’s potential cabinet appointments. The episode also covers the internal struggles of Reform UK amidst Nigel Farage’s expense scandal and debates the likelihood of an early general election.
